Floods endanger lives and cause human tragedy as well as heavy economic losses. In addition to economic and social damage, floods can have severe environmental consequences, for example when installations holding large quantities of toxic chemicals are inundated or wetland areas destroyed. Intense precipitation has become more frequent and more intense, growing manmade pressure has increased the magnitude of floods that result from any level of precipitation, and flawed decisions about the location of human infrastructure have increased the flood loss potential. Flooding cannot be wholly prevented. Flood risk increases with ongoing climate change. Risk reduction in large international basins can only be achieved through transnational, interdisciplinary and stakeholder oriented approaches within the framework of a joint transnational research project. The overall objective of FLOOD-serv is to develop and to provide a pro-active and personalised citizen-centric public service application that will enhance the involvement of the citizen and will harness the collaborative power of ICT networks (networks of people, of knowledge, of sensors) to raise awareness on flood risks and to enable collective risk mitigation solutions and response actions. Other general objectives are: 1. Empowering local communities to directly participate in the design of emergency services dealing with floods mitigation actions. 2. Harness the power of new technologies, such as social media, and mobile technologies to increase the efficiency of public administrations in raising public awareness and education regarding floods risks, effects and impact. 3. Encourage the development and implementation of long-term, cost-effective and environmentally sound mitigation actions related to floods though an ICT-enabled cooperation and collaboration of all stakeholders: government, private sector, NGOs and other civil society organizations as well as citizens.

To achieve its ambitious goals, the project will develop an integrated common assessment framework consistent across scales for modelling, simulating and evaluating impacts and risks of climate change, as well as policy measures. Climate science and Earth Systems information (1); methods for impacts (2) and risks analysis (3); social knowledge (4) are included in the models for delivering multi-sectoral climate impact assessments under consistent and integrated socio-economic and climate scenarios. The NEVERMORE approach integrates information from physical modelling of impacts and risk analysis methodologies and aligns them across different scales: from national, EU and global scales (in the IAM) to local and regional scales via five case studies (Sitia-Crete-GR, Trentino-IT, Västerbotten and Norrbotten-SE, Murcia-ES, Danube delta-RO) that represent various socio-ecological EU contexts. Consistency among the different scales is ensured by combining bottom-up and top-down approaches. The NEVERMORE assessment framework will be embedded in a practical and user-friendly ICT toolkit, including decision-making tools, designed and developed with and for different stakeholders and end-users involved throughout the project via five Local and a Transnational Council of Stakeholders, by leveraging social innovation frameworks, participatory processes and co-design techniques. NEVERMORE’s ultimate goal is to better understand the interactions between mitigation and adaptation policies and measures to deliver sound technical and policy recommendations towards a climate neutral and resilient society.

EcoDaLLi, embedded in the Mission 'Restore our Ocean, seas & waters by 2030' will help achieve freshwater targets of European Green Deal, integrating a systemic approach for restoration, protection & preservation for the entire Danube Basin, provided by coordinated actions. The main objective of EcoDaLLi is to centralise Danube governance structures in terms of innovative solutions for improved ecological restoration, protection and preservation of the Danube basin and its Delta by fostering a stronger innovation ecosystem within a well-connected Practices Living Lab System, supported by a digital Portal, completly linked to the Mission Implementation Platform. Innovative solutions open new opportunities for better water restoration, taking into consideration social innovation aspects, reducing climate change effects and reducing also costs. An improved governance at Danube Basin level, based on dedicated EcoDaLLi tools will foster such innovative solutions, change mindsets on water ecosystems restoration and climate change and develop value chains based on ecosystem services. This will contribute to the decarbonisation goal of Green Deal, cleaner water, improved state of the environment, land creation of jobs in sensitive areas along the basin, especially in the Danube Delta. EcoDaLLi will support innovators connect to governance structures, providing and maintaining networks, trough dedicated Living Labs for knowledge co-creation, workshops, a custom made digital portal for synergies, and innovation support services, to experiment with new solutions, helping the innovation ecosystem to create circular services towards Sustainable Blue Economy in the Danube Basin and beyond.
